Offer description

An exciting opportunity has arisen for an experienced and enthusiastic HR & People Manager to join our team at Lifelink. This is a new senior management role within the organisation, ideally suited to an individual who thrives on embedding best in class HR practices, and develops positive workplace culture throughout our organisation.


ROLE SUMMARY

At Lifelink, people are at the heart of everything we do. As our HR & People Manager, you’ll play a central role in shaping a culture that empowers and inspires. You’ll join a purpose-driven organisation committed to wellbeing, development, and making a lasting difference to the communities we serve.

You will be a professional with experience in human resources management, people and cultural development. You will be capable of leading and implementing all aspects of the HR function, including the team, aligned with the organisation’s goals and objectives. A key focus will be developing a coaching and mentoring culture that empowers managers and employees to take ownership of performance, growth, and wellbeing.

You will demonstrate strong decision making and act with integrity, ensuring all people practices are aligned with organisational values and ethical standards. You will act as a trusted advisor and influencer across all levels of the organisation, building credibility and ensuring HR initiatives have meaningful impact.

You will balance strategic leadership with hands on HR delivery, strengthening leadership capability, embedding a culture of continuous learning, and driving positive organisational change.


You must have:

* Experience in a similar HR & People Manager role, with experience of line managing a team.
* A Batchelor’s degree in Human Resources Management or related field.
* A passion for cultural and change leadership with experience guiding and supporting organisations through periods of transformation.
* Experience of leading employee engagement and wellbeing initiatives promoting a positive workplace culture.
* The ability to analyse data, driving insight led decisions and change.
* Experience embedding equality, diversity and inclusion at the heart of our people strategy and culture.
* The ability to effectively manage relationships across the organisation to deliver HR business partner support on a day-to-day basis, supporting with queries and complex escalated scenarios.
* Knowledge and experience of managing TUPE processes and implementing employee legislation change.
* The ability to lead and develop our performance management framework, and our training and development programmes.
* Experience of driving a coaching and mentoring led culture, fostering a continuous learning and feedback environment.
* The ability to manage and implement the full talent lifecycle, from recruitment, development and retention.
* Experience of organisational design and development including workforce and succession planning and leadership development.
* Experience of managing external stakeholder relationships to gain and maintain accreditations and charters such as IIP.


Ideally you will have:

* Membership of an HR related body.
* Additional coaching, change management, or organisational development qualification.
* Experience of working for or partnering with a 3rd sector organisation.
* A strong understanding of the mental health and wellbeing sector.


Hours, Location & Salary

Part Time - 21 hours per week Monday – Friday (work pattern to be agreed)


Location

Glasgow / Hybrid.


Salary Band

Grade 7 - £34,763 – £48,070 dependent on experience (pro rata)

Additional benefits include generous holiday allowance, contributory pension scheme (6% from employer), cash back health plan, life cover, holiday purchase scheme, and 2 wellbeing days.

About us

Lifelink and Lifelink Workwell is a social enterprise with over 30 years of experience supporting adults and young people throughout Scotland, and UK wide workplaces, with their mental health and wellbeing. Our vision is that people are healthier and happier, wherever they live, work or learn.
